Description
The U.S. Department of Commerce has issued final results for the expedited second sunset review of the countervailing duty order on welded line pipe from the Republic of Türkiye. The review finds that revocation of the order would likely lead to continuation or recurrence of countervailable subsidies at specified rates. The notice includes details on the scope of the order, the review process, and the subsidy rates for specific producers/exporters. Interested parties were invited to participate and submit comments during the review process.
